In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ding TN25 5AX,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.6%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Kempes Place was 22.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 21.2% lower than the Bircholt average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Kempes Place has the 15th lowest crime rate of 54 local areas in Bircholt and the 67th lowest crime rate of 393 local areas in Ashford .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 8.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-75.0%.

TN25 5AX area has a high level of entrepreneurship. Only 18%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 13%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.
TN25 5AX area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
The percentage of retired residents living in TN25 5AX area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 45%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
